ED 380 - Theory and Methods of Teaching Elementary Mathematics


Mathematics methods explores the nature of learning and teaching mathematics with an emphasis on developing student understanding through active involvement. Using experiences with a variety of instructional materials, classroom activities with children, and diverse teaching strategies, students develop an understanding of mathematical concepts and procedures.

Four credits.

Prerequisite(s): ED 130  and ED 340  or students may obtain permission from the instructor.
